The Allure of the 98% RTP
One of the most striking features of this game is its exceptionally high Return to Player (RTP) of 98%. This means that, on average, players can expect to receive 98% of their wagers back over the long term. In the world of gaming, an RTP of 98% is significantly above the industry standard, making this title particularly appealing to players seeking a favorable edge. The high RTP isn’t merely a matter of luck; it is dynamically adjusted based on player performance, encouraging skill-based play.
It’s important to note that RTP is a theoretical figure calculated over millions of gameplays. However, the consistently high RTP in this title reinforces a feeling of fairness and offers a greater sense of control to the player. The transparency regarding the RTP further builds trust and demonstrates the developer’s commitment to providing a rewarding gaming experience.
